Before we ship, note that the Fernlock tile cache now evicts by render cost rather than LRU, which changes memory behavior under zoom-heavy sessions. I verified the new limits against the staging replay, but they should be in the release notes. The constants controlling eviction and prewarm are these.

constants for yajog-tajep:
QUOTAS = {
    "fenir": 536,
    "normir": 443,
    "fenath": 793,
}

## Deployment

Reviewer note: the session-token refresh bug in Quillgate v2.4 stems from the refresher racing the expiry sweep. Fix moves refresh to a single worker with a jittered interval; expiry sweep now respects the refresh lock. Deploy requires a rolling restart — do not drain all pods at once or tokens minted mid-deploy will skip refresh. Canary on the Veldmark cluster first, then promote. Verify the worker logs one refresh cycle before promoting. The values below must match staging exactly.

service settings:
[casax]
port = 6379
team = rusir
host = casax.zemvarhq.corp
region = outer-4
access_code = ac_9808ce
timeout_ms = 1500

Ticket: Crashfall ingest failing on staging

New folks, please read carefully. The Pebblekit mobile app's crash reports aren't reaching the symbolication queue because staging's env file was copied without its upload credential. Symptoms: 401s in the collector logs every five minutes. To fix, add the missing line to the env file, exactly as follows.

secret setting of fafop-tagep: VAULT_KEY29=6a815d21e2d77cc25ef1802d73ee6

Ticket TL-442: The staging instance of Chronoplan, our school timetable solver, was deployed with the production solver queue credentials. This means staging runs can enqueue jobs against live district schedules at Hollowbrook Academy. We need to rotate the affected credential and point staging at its own queue. For the security review, note that the fix requires updating the staging .env with the following line:

vault entry, tagug-hahip: ARCHIVE_KEY3=e34